Take notice that St. John’s Municipal Plan Amendment Number 14, 2024, and St. John’s Development Regulations Amendment Number 40, 2024, adopted on September 3, 2024, and approved on April 9, 2025, have been registered by the Minister of Municipal and Provincial Affairs.
In general terms, the purpose of St. John’s Municipal Plan Amendment Number 14, 2024, is to redesignate land at 188 New Pennywell Road from the Rural District to the Residential District, to allow a Cluster Development.

The City has received an application from 86755 Newfoundland & Labrador Inc. to rezone 8 Shaw Street and 4 McLea Place from the Residential Special (RA) Zone to the Residential 1 (R1) Zone. The property is in the Residential District of the Envision St. John’s Municipal Plan, so a Municipal Plan amendment is not needed.
